E267 LOU is a 1988 Renault 5 in Blue with a 1,237c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 3 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 33.3%.
Across all 1988 Renault 5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.1% with a typical mileage of 73,560 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ault 5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,884 recorded failures. If you're considering buying E267 LOU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ault 5 typically stays on UK roads for around 42 years. At 38 years old, this Renault 5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
